Overview
The complexities of designing piles for lateral loads are manifold as there are many forces that are critical to the design of big structures such as bridges, offshore and waterfront structures, and retaining walls. The loads on structures should be supported either horizontally or laterally or in both directions and most structures have in common that they are founded on piles. To create solid foundations, the pile designer is driven towards finding the critical load on a certain structure, either by causing overloaded or by causing too much lateral deflection. This third edition of Single Piles and Pile Groups Under Lateral Loading explores and explains design and analysis procedures for laterally loaded piles and pile groups, accounting for the nonlinear soil resistance, as related to the lateral deflection of the pile. It addresses the analysis of piles of varying stiffness installed into soils and rock formations with a variety of characteristics, accounting for the axial load at the top of the pile and for the rotational restrain of the pile head. The presented method using load-transfer functions is currently applied in practice by thousands of engineering offices in the world. Moreover, various experimental case design examples are given to complement theory. The rich list of relevant publications will serve the user for further reading. Numerous developments have taken place in the years since the second edition was published. Hence, new features in this third edition have been added, and it includes new chapters on p-y criteria for crushable soils and rock formations, and a chapter on new challenges in analysis and design of monopiles for offshore wind turbine foundations and drilled piers with large-diameters. Additional subjects treated include updated group reduction factors on the behavior of pile groups with a large number of piles, and the substructure method which is used in current engineering practices for laterally-loaded piles under dynamic loading. Designed as a textbook for senior undergraduate/graduate student courses in pile engineering and foundation engineering and related subject areas, this third edition of Single Piles and Pile Groups Under Lateral Loading is also aimed at professionals in civil and mining engineering and in applied earth sciences.
